Quotes to Consider:
John Calvin on Philippians 3:10: "But as it is not enough to know
Christ as crucified and raised up from the dead, unless you
experience, also, the fruit of this, he speaks expressly of efficacy.
Christ therefore is rightly known, when we feel how powerful his death
and resurrection are, and how efficacious they are in us. Now all
things are there furnished to us—expiation and destruction of sin,
freedom from condemnation, satisfaction, victory over death, the
attainment of righteousness, and the hope of a blessed immortality."
